yfinance-mcp is a Python-based Model Context Protocol (MCP) server designed to interface with the yfinance library, providing a structured way to access and manage financial data.

The yfinance-mcp server acts as a bridge between the yfinance library and various client applications, allowing users to retrieve and manipulate financial data in a standardized format. This server leverages the capabilities of the yfinance library, which is widely used for accessing financial data from Yahoo Finance, and wraps it in an MCP server to facilitate easier integration with other systems. By using yfinance-mcp, developers can create applications that require financial data without having to directly interact with the yfinance library, thus simplifying the development process and ensuring consistency in data handling.
